Spinner Vansh Akbari spins web as he bags a fifer vs Gamdevi Cricketers in G Division Kanga League’24

vansh akbari kanga league

Gamdevi Cricketers batting first at Cross Maidan in Mumbai were all out for 107 runs in their first innings with Devansh Trivedi scoring half of the team runs with an unbeaten half century. The bowler who stood out in the match was none other Vansh Akbari, a promising left arm spinner from DY Cricket Academy in Mumbai who returned with a fifer to dismantle Gamdevi’s innings. Left-arm spinner Vansh took 5/21 and was instrumental in restricting Gamdevi to a low total.

Blue Star CC in reply were all out for 99 runs with Pranav Yadav scoring 49 runs. Gamdevi Cricketers in 2nd innings were 72 for no loss before the end of the game’s play where Gamdevi won the match on 1st innings lead.
